All posts by Matthew Bedford. What Is Orthodoxy And Why Does It Matter? 27 June, 2016. The word “orthodoxy” refers to the generally held doctrines of the Christian church. When someone talks about the orthodox teachings of the Church, they are talking about beliefs that are held more or less strongly by all branches of the Christian Church. This includes the evangelical church, the Catholic church, the Orthodox church, the Lutheran church, and their many branches and offshoots. Why does this matter?

The Failure Of The Progressive Dream. 14 October, 2014. Intelligent people going back thousands of years have returned again and again to desiring a particular type of leader: The Philosopher King. Some leaders have actually tried to embody Plato’s Kallipolisian ideal, including Marcus Aurelius of Rome and Matthias Corvinus of Hungary and Croatia, not just by being super-intelligent, but by studying and applying the craft of leadership, the ideas and ideals of kingship and stewardship.
